The report explores the potential for social justice organizations in the Majority World to transition to alternative social media platforms, such as Mastodon and BlueSky, as a way to address the concerns and limitations of mainstream platforms like Facebook and Twitter. The research highlights the need to address technological barriers, build resilience against online harms, and strengthen organizational capacity in order to successfully develop an ecosystem of community-centered alternatives.
